While Karate is an excellent way to improve physical fitness, it also equips students with essential self-defence skills.

The techniques taught in Karate are designed not only to improve strength and agility but also to provide practical skills for protecting oneself.
By learning how to defend against strikes, grapples, and other threats, Karate gives students the confidence that they are prepared for unexpected situations.
Beyond the practical aspects of self-defence, Karate instils a deep sense of empowerment. As you progress in your training, you begin to feel stronger, more capable, and more confident in your ability to protect yourself and others.
The discipline, focus, and self-control learned through Karate are essential components of empowerment. Students often report feeling a greater sense of security and assertiveness in their daily lives after taking up martial arts.
In addition to self-defence, Karate teaches students the importance of awareness. Situational awareness is a key component of self-defence—it’s about being alert to your surroundings and recognising potential threats before they escalate.
Karate training sharpens this awareness, enabling students to respond to situations with clarity and control.
Self-Defence and Empowerment Through Martial Arts
Martial arts training offers more than just physical fitness; it provides individuals with the tools to protect themselves and the confidence to navigate the world assertively.
Practising self-defence techniques in a supportive environment empowers students to respond effectively to potential threats, fostering a sense of safety and control.
Through consistent training, individuals develop heightened awareness, improved decision-making skills, and the ability to remain calm under pressure.
These attributes not only enhance personal safety but also contribute to overall well-being and self-assurance.
